Climate change is the most pressing crisis humanity is dealing with right now, and startup founders and investors are racing to build and fund solutions.

The importance of impact investing, plus friendlier legislation, has fueled the rush to climate tech both in the US and Europe. Celebrities and established venture capitalists are "greening up" their portfolios, pouring billions into a sector once regarded as niche.

Leonardo DiCaprio-backed fund Regeneration VC, for example, has handed checks to founders building everything from carbon utilization to rental companies.

That meant, as capital dried up in the wider market, climate and sustainability-focused companies continued to raise throughout last year. Venture capitalists also raised funds from limited partners to focus on investing on climate tech.

Globally, climate and clean tech startups raised $54 billion in 2022, according to PitchBook. It is a near $13 billion-drop from the record levels raised in 2021, a year flush with cash and largely considered an outlier, but almost double 2020's $28 billion. Clean tech refers to startups trying to reduce human impact on the environment, while climate tech covers those on mitigation, adaptation, and decarbonization.

Advertisement

The sector may not remain immune to the broader slowdown in funding, with early data showing investment activity tailing off in the first quarter of 2023 to a near three-year low.
